Help Wanted: QC Lab Tech With Chemist Experience
|
 |
Job Description:
Quality Services
Reports to Director of Quality
Position Role
The position is an integral part of the Quality Services Team. The position will be responsible for:
•Color matching purchased bulk and preparing quantitative formula and cost per gallon.
•Performing stability for color matched shade and documenting results.
•Assisting Compounding Department on pilot batches of color match shade.
•Evaluating in-process bulk, pre-ship samples of nail lacquers, treatments and all other purchased bulk.
•Complete Non-conforming Notice (NCN) and coordinate disposition of affected materials.
•Monitor temperature of refrigerator used to store nail lacquer standard & incubator.
•Assisting other areas of the Department as needed.
Essential Functions
•Properly handle and control all documents in accordance with Document Control Procedures.
•Correspond with commodity buyer, Marketing Dept (if applicable) & vendor on approvals / rejections of materials on a timely manner.
•Maintain an awareness of cGMP’s and cGLP’s and maintains compliance with these regulations; Documents all activities associated with cGMP compliance (i. e. instrument calibration, OOS investigations etc. ).
•Demonstrate the ability to multi-task and to set own priorities based on operations schedule and deadlines.
•Participate in equipment validation program.
•Utilize laboratory equipment such as viscometer, pycnometer, densitometer, pH meter etc.
•Develop Standard Operating Procedures.
•Maintain good housekeeping and safety in the work area.
Essential Qualifications
•At least 2 year’s experience in Cosmetic / Pharmaceutical industry and color matching a shade.
•Motivated and work well with others.
•Ability to multi-task and has a take charge attitude.
•Knowledge of cGMP and FDA regulations.
•Knowledge of instrumentation usage such as viscometer, pH meter, etc.
•Must have organizational skills, computer skills, analytical skills, decision-making skills and good communication skills.
•Regulatory experience in a plus.
